Importance of Ethical Sourcing and Transparency
Choosing brands that are transparent about their supply chain and ethical practices is crucial.
This includes understanding where materials come from, how workers are treated, and the environmental impact of production.
For instance, brands that use organic cotton, recycled polyester, or innovative sustainable fabrics like TENCEL™ demonstrate a commitment to reducing their ecological footprint.

- Cotopaxi
- Focus: Outdoor gear and apparel, often made from repurposed materials.
- Ethical Stance: Certified B Corporation and a strong advocate for ethical manufacturing and giving back to communities. Their “Gear for Good” initiative focuses on sustainable materials and responsible production.
- Product Range: Backpacks, jackets, fleeces, and lifestyle apparel. Many products feature unique colorways due to their use of repurposed fabrics.
- Why it’s a good alternative: Combines vibrant, functional design with a strong social mission and commitment to sustainability.
